Originally Posted by Padgett View Post
As said it is a cigarette lighter socket but somehow TM found some that are about .1 mm smaller in diameter than an American lighter. I have just forced in dual lighter adapters with a bit of sanding on both and leave them there.

ps
12-volt cigar lighter receptacle and plug, size A
Receptacle inside diameter: 20.93 - 21.01 mm (median 20.97 mm)
Plug body diameter: 20.73 - 20.88 mm (median 20.805 mm)

12-volt cigar lighter receptacle and plug, size B
Receptacle inside diameter: 21.41 - 21.51 mm (median 21.455 mm)
Plug body diameter: 21.13 - 21.33 mm (median 21.18 mm)

Hard to put a 21.13 mm pug into a 21.01mm socket worse if other end of tolerance

Padgett, are you saying the dimensions of the two outlets in your trailer are different sizes or are you saying that that there are two different plug sizes made and they are distinguished by A and B? If the latter then presumably we could search the Internet for a matching plug size???
